Photography Workshop


Taking time out of her busy schedule, visual artist and photographer, Arpita Shah spent two afternoons with our S6 Higher Photography pupils showing them how to work in the studio environment.

Discussing her own practice, Arpita explored culture, heritage and identity with pupils through photography and film.

Tasked with creating a portrait of a staff member of their choice, the pupils have captured some wonderfully candid moments with their teachers.

As well-known German born American photo journalist Alfred Eisenstaedt said:“It is more important to click with people than to click the shutter.
